This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

[参考译文] MSP430FR6047:USS 水流温度

Guru**** 2609955 points


请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

https://e2e.ti.com/support/microcontrollers/msp-low-power-microcontrollers-group/msp430/f/msp-low-power-microcontroller-forum/1571542/msp430fr6047-uss-water-flow-temperature

器件型号:MSP430FR6047


工具/软件:

我正在尝试使用 MSP30FR6047EVM 和 USS 库构建水表传感器。 我需要从 USS_ALGORIES 中提取温度计算结果。
我做了以下更新在 USS_userConfig.h :

  • 将 USS_ALG_ENABLE_EVIMATE_TEMPERATURE 设置 为 TRUE
  • 将 USS_声 学长度设置 为 70 (因为传感器的距离约为 70mm)
  • 将 USS_VOLUME_SCALE_FACTOR 设置 为 2.5484e7f


初始调试步骤是、我通过 Algorithms_Results 打印所有 USS_UART、这里是输出
AbsTof_UPS 5.4188e-05
AbsTof_DNS 5.4188e-05
DToF –2.9502e-11.
VoL_FR –5.1807e+00
温度 3.6301e+02

我不知道为什么温度值为 363 度
我检查了 USS_runAlgorithms 是否没有错误(我们的消息代码输出为:USS_message_code = 122)

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    尊敬的 Toby:

    您是否尝试过不要更改任何内容来读取温度值? 会有更多专家来发表评论。

    谢谢!

    此致

    Johnson

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    是、下面是配置的输出、不对 USS_userConfig.h  头文件进行任何更改:  


    AbsTof_UPS、5.4351e-05
    AbsTof_DNS、5.4352e-05
    DToF、–1.1509e-09
    VoL_FR、–4.9639e+00
    acc_flow、4.2400e+02
    温度、2.9398e-01

    我现在看到的是现在的温度是 0.29398  

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好!

    我仍在寻求对此的意见。

    谢谢、

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

     Johnson He 我仍然希望通过温度读数来解决这个问题。 对于我为什么看到这些数字、您有什么想法吗?